Хранитель сетевых профилей Mobile Net SwitchАвтор: Андрей Кучеров Опубликовано: 16.07.2008 Источник: SoftKey.info 
Программа Mobile Net Switch компании RH Computing будет интересна владельцам ноутбуков, благо таковых сейчас едва ли не больше, чем хозяев обычных компьютеров. Итак, типичная ситуация – ноутбук дома, настроен на домашнюю точку доступа WiFi и все настройки получает по DHCP. Локальная сеть отключена (ибо не нужна). Исходящий почтовый сервер SMTP, прописанный в любимой программе, – бесплатный, например, smtp.mail.ru. Все прекрасно работает. Понадобилось взять ноутбук на работу – что может быть проще? Берем у администратора IP-адреса для ноутбука, шлюза и DNS-серверов, включаем ноутбук в локальную сеть и отключаем по его требованию WiFi (администратор попался грамотный и знает, какая это опасная вещь - два одновременно работающих сетевых подключения). Все? Нет, надо прописать еще прокси-сервер в браузере и поменять настройки smtp на локальный в почтовой программе – выход на наружные SMTP-серверы заботливо прикрыт. Все? Почти – для полного счастья надо подключить несколько сетевых ресурсов и установить принтером по умолчанию не струйник, стоящий дома, а лазерный МФУ с первого этажа офиса. Все? Все. Поработали. Идем домой, моментом выставляем IP-адрес на DHCP, SMTP-сервер на mail.ru. Или на smtp.mail.ru? Где-то был сохранен текстовой файлик с настройками... А Интернет почему не работает? Ах, да, прокси-сервер! И "Проводник" жалуется на то, что не видит сетевых дисков, – ерунда, не обращаем внимания. На следующий день на работе с утра - включаем, отключаем, прописываем, меняем. Дома – в обратном порядке. Надо провести презентацию у клиента – включаем, отключаем, прописываем. Зашли к другу на выходных в гости – вновь включаем, отключаем, прописываем. Помните бабушку из анекдота? "Открыла кошелку, вытащила сумку, закрыла кошелку, открыла сумку, достала кошелек, закрыла сумку, открыла кошелку, положила сумку". Чтобы не повторять судьбу бабушки, нужно воспользоваться программой Mobile Net Switch. Предназначена она для легкого переключения между профилями с различными настройками сетей. Профиль, однажды созданный, выбирается потом двумя щелчками мыши, что гораздо быстрее, чем смена параметров вручную. Список хранимых данных очень велик и включает в себя такие основные настройки, как IP-адреса для определенных сетевых адаптеров, шлюзов и DNS-серверов, прокси-серверов, параметры для подключения к сетевым ресурсам, соединение с Интернетом по умолчанию. Для эстетов - возможность запомнить фон рабочего стола, громкость звука и состояние NumLock. Для продвинутых - три варианта выставления NetBIOS over TCP/IP и возможность переключения MAC-адреса. Для профессионалов - задание скриптов.  | | Интерфейс Mobile Net Switch | Что требуется для создания профиля? Запустить программу. Напротив строки Connection profile нажать Add и ввести имя создаваемого профиля. Профиль создан, и можно редактировать его настройки. Вкладка Main содержит настройки для подключения сетевых дисков и прокси-серверов (спорное решение разработчиков - мне кажется, адресация куда главнее). Изменения параметров подключения к прокси-серверу поддерживается напрямую для браузеров Internet Explorer и FireFox. Вкладка Network - выбор и конфигурирование сетевых подключений. Что приятно, в отличие от предыдущих версий поддерживается присваивание одновременно нескольких IP-адресов - удобно при настройках сетевого оборудования. У каждого из производителей такого оборудования свои настройки по умолчанию, и при использовании Mobile Net Switch достаточно сохранить адрес и маску из той же подсети в качестве вторичного адреса, чтобы в любой момент можно было подключиться к настраиваемому оборудованию, не теряя подключения к основной сети. Вкладка Internet - стартовая страница по умолчанию, диалап-подключения, правила дозвона. Кстати, из главного меню, пункт Options, можно применить к редактируемому профилю текущие настроки прокси-серверов и сетевой адресации. По кнопке Advanced Options открывается окно с дополнительными настройками - включение-отключение стандартного сетевого экрана Windows, задание DNS-суффикса, настройки NetBIOS, возможность изменения MAC-адреса, очистки кеша DNS. Тут же можно задать обязательную перезагрузку сетевой карты при применении профиля. Вкладка Desktop - рабочий стол, клавиша NumLock, разрешение экрана, громкость звука. К сожалению, не могу придумать, с какой целью на ноутбуке потребуется поменять разрешение экрана. Если только при подключении к проектору для проведения презентации. Вкладка System - выбор принтера по умолчанию, временной зоны, профилей почтовых программ. Здесь же - настройка сервера SMTP. Динамическое переключение таких серверов организовано просто и красиво - в настройках любой используемой пользователем почтовой программы в качестве SMTP-сервера прописывается строка DynamicSMTP, а при выборе профиля в файле hosts задается соответствие этого символьного имени и IP-адреса реального сервера (именно реальный сервер мы указываем на вкладке System). Недостаток такого универсального метода в том, что для корректной работы требуются идентичные настройки авторизации SMTP - или не применяются вообще, или применяются с одинаковой парой логин/пароль. Вкладка Host позволяет изменять настройки одноименного файла. Один из примеров использования приведен выше. Вкладка Scripts служит для выбора скриптов - программ или иных файлов (файлов реестра, пакетных), запускаемых до или после применения сетевого профиля. Здесь пользователю предоставляется обширное поле для творчества - по своему потенциалу одна эта вкладка способна заменить все остальные. Именно поэтому, как мне кажется, она будет применяться крайне редко - любители командной строки могут справиться с переключением профилей самостоятельно, не они будут пользователями Mobile Net Switch. Вкладка Remarks. Ключевая из всего набора - в ней можно записать любые произвольные текстовые комментарии к профилю, скажем, место и время, где он применялся, телефон местного системного администратора и другие не менее важные заметки. На странице помощи программы, например, приведен, как мне кажется, шикарный пример - записано время, в которое закрывается здание. Все настройки сохраняются автоматически, по мере ввода. При запуске программы (вручную или автоматически при запуске операционной системы) в системной панели появляется иконка программы. Двойной щелчок запускает главное окно, одинарный - маленькое окошко с выбором уже созданных профилей и единственной кнопкой Activate. Один из профилей можно сделать профилем по умолчанию - и тогда при щелчке по Activate при зажатой клавище Ctrl выберется именно он. Существует и другой путь запуска - можно скачать с сайта программы бесплатную утилитку QMNS, скопировать ее в каталог программы, вывести ярлычок под руку - на рабочий стол или панель быстрого запуска, и тогда переключать профили удобнее будет именно с ее помощью - или мышкой, щелкая на кнопке с именем нужного профиля, или функциональными клавишами, начиная с F1.  | | Лаунчер QMNS | Интерфейс программы - только английский, возможности смены языка не предусмотрено. С другой стороны, аббревиатуры DNS, WINS, файл hosts переводу не подлежат в любом случае. Время переключения между профилями - порядка нескольких секунд.
Одно из декларируемых достоинств программы - исправная работа под правами простого пользователя, не администратора (кроме изменения IP-адресации, в этом случае все-таки потребуется задать заранее логин/пароль администратора) и полное равнодушие к переключению профилей со стороны User Account Control (UAC) в Windows Vista. Насколько это необходимо на личном ноутбуке - решать вам. Впрочем, на служебном ноутбуке, переходящем из рук в руки и настраиваемом системным администратором, эти особенности могут оказаться кстати. В ту же копилку системного администратора с набором опекаемых ноутбуков - опциональный режим User Mode, в котором невозможно менять предварительно созданные настройки. Подведем итоги. Программа Mobile Net Switch будет полезна мобильным владельцам ноутбуков, которым часто приходится подключаться к традиционным локальным, беспроводным и коммутируемым сетям. Польза будет заключаться в значительном повышении удобства подключения, что оставит больше времени на саму работу в сети. Немаловажно то, что увеличится и безопасность работы, ведь ноутбук, подключенный к локальной сети Ethernet в офисе, на котором забыли выключить поиск "публичного" WiFi, очень легко становится входной точкой для атаки на локальную сеть - достаточно показать ему искомую точку доступа WiFi, контролируемую злоумышленниками. В программе же можно четко прописать отключение WiFi в профиле для рабочей сети. Таким образом, и системные администраторы с начальниками отделов, отвечающие за парк ноутбуков, не должны пройти мимо - особенности лицензирования программы с возможностью пакетной, оптовой продажи лицензий также отвечают требованиям этой категории пользователей.
Альтернативы? С ноутбуками некоторых вендоров идут подобные утилитки для домашних пользователей - более красивые и нарядные, но с меньшим функционалом. Для профессионалов-одиночек - скрипты с использованием reg-файлов и могучей команды netsh командной строки Windows.
|